In my experience, no matter how many techniques I try, steaming seitan is always a must. Boiling seitan makes it have a brainy spongey texture, frying seitan (without first steaming it) makes it rubbery and spongey, baking it makes it dry and rubbery. Steaming seitan, on the other hand, will yield the perfect meaty, juicy, chewy, yet tender seitan every single time. So even though I tried to get away with a one-pot recipe, it just didn't work for this recipe. The key is to first steam the seitan (which takes only 10 minutes) and then pan fry it for that crispy outside. Vegan chicken perfection! The Quickest & Easiest Seitan Recipe! (Vegan Chicken!) How to make the quickest and easiest seitan recipe:

The Quickest & Easiest Seitan Recipe! (Vegan Chicken!) (4) Add about an inch of water to a pot with a steamer basket and bring to a light boil. In the meantime, whisk together the vital wheat gluten, flour, vegetable broth powder, onion powder, garlic powder, and salt in a medium bowl. The Quickest & Easiest Seitan Recipe! (Vegan Chicken!) (5) Pour in the water and mix to form a ball of dough. The Quickest & Easiest Seitan Recipe! (Vegan Chicken!) (6) Lightly grease the steamer basket, then tear off bite-sized pieces of the seitan dough and place them in a single layer in the steamer basket. The Quickest & Easiest Seitan Recipe! (Vegan Chicken!) (7) Cover, and steam the seitan for 10 minutes. In the meantime, in a small bowl or a measuring glass, mix together the Thai sweet chili sauce, hoisin, soy sauce, water, rice vinegar, and sesame oil. Set aside. (See notes for other sauce options). The Quickest & Easiest Seitan Recipe! (Vegan Chicken!) (8) When the seitan is done steaming, heat 2 tablespoons of oil in a large skillet or non-stick pan. Use tongs to remove the seitan bites from the steamer basket, and place them into the hot oil in the pan. Be careful as it may splatter. Cook the seitan bites a few minutes per side until they are golden brown and crispy. The Quickest & Easiest Seitan Recipe! (Vegan Chicken!) (9) Remove from the heat and add the sauce and toss to coat. The Quickest & Easiest Seitan Recipe! (Vegan Chicken!) (10) Garnish with green onions and sesame seeds if desired and serve hot. Notes

Sauce options: the sauce recipe I provided is just one idea. You could sauce this seitan anyway you like! Just fry the seitan in oil, then stir in your favourite sauce. Any of my 12 seitan marinades would work great as a sauce!

Oil-free:I love how crispy the seitan gets by frying it in oil, but if you prefer oil-free, try frying it in a dry non-stick pan, grilling it, or tossing it in your air fryer.

Make-Ahead: you can prepare this seitan completely, let it cool, and then store in an air-tight in the fridge for 3 - 5 days. The seitan will be chewier when cold. Alternatively, you could allow the seitan to cool after steaming (but before frying) and store the steamed seitan in the fridge, then you can fry it fresh.

Freezing: seitan freezes wonderfully, allow the seitan to cool after steaming (but before frying) and store in an air-tight container in the freezer.

Vital wheat glutenis essential to this recipe, and there is no substitute. Therefore this recipe cannot be made gluten-free. For a vegan gluten-free chicken inspired recipe try myBaked Tofu Bitesrecipe.

Steaming tips: you need to steam the seitan bites before using them. I recommend getting a steamer potif you plan to make seitan often, or you can use aDIY methodif you do not have a steamer.

Cleaning tips:vital wheat gluten is very sticky and can destroy dish brushes and cloths. So what I like to do is save old clothes, sheets, or towels that are too shabby to donate, and cut them into rags. I use these rags to clean up after preparing a seitan recipe and discard the rag once finished.

    I’ve never just steamed the seitan before until this recipe. Not the biggest fan compared to how I learned to make it In culinary school.

    I was taught to make sauté some onion and garlic and then add tomato paste to give it some more umami taste . Then I blend that paste with the remaining ingredients except for flours. Then you mix the flours with the wet mixture for about 3 minutes. The more you knead, the more texture you get.

    Shape it in to a log or rectangular block and cover tightly with foil and poach it in boiling broth or water for an hour. Let sit in pot for another 30 minutes. Unwrap and store it in air right container with liquid for atleast 8 hours. Sauté when ready to cook.

    This stays good in fridge for about a week and you can even freeze it.

    Another tip: if you want a lighter texture in your seitan, try using chickpea flour instead of AP 🙂
